GetDroop(string, ref double[])
- Updated2025-10-13
- 1 minute(s) read
Gets the droop values computed for all measured pulses. Droop values are defined as the rate at which the pulse top levels decays from the beginning to the end during On duration. This value is expressed in units specified by SetMetricsAmplitudeDeviationUnit(string, RFmxPulseMXPulseMetricsAmplitudeDeviationUnit) method.
Syntax
Namespace: NationalInstruments.RFmx.PulseMX
public int GetDroop(string selectorString, ref double[] value)
Remarks
This method gets the value of PulseResultsDroop attribute.
Parameters
|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| selectorString | string | Specifies the result name. |
| value | ref double[] | Upon return, contains the droop values computed for all measured pulses. Droop values are defined as the rate at which the pulse top levels decays from the beginning to the end during On duration. This value is expressed in units specified by SetMetricsAmplitudeDeviationUnit(string, RFmxPulseMXPulseMetricsAmplitudeDeviationUnit) method. |
Returns
Returns the status code of this method. The status code either indicates success or describes a warning condition.
